6 / 69 page ![]() 7 Specifications 7.1 Absolute Maximum Ratings over operating ambient temperature range (unless otherwise noted)(1) MIN MAX UNIT Power supply pin voltage (VM, VIN_AVDD) –0.3 24 V Power supply voltage ramp during power up (VM) 2 V/µs Voltage difference between ground pins (PGND, AGND) –0.3 0.3 V Charge pump voltage (CP) –0.3 VM + 6 V Analog regulator pin voltage (AVDD) –0.3 4 V Logic pin input voltage (INHx, INLx, nSCS, nSLEEP, SCLK, SDI, GAIN, MODE, SLEW) –0.3 6 V Logic pin output voltage (SDO) –0.3 6 V Open drain pin output voltage (nFAULT) –0.3 6 V Open drain output current range (nFAULT) 0 5 mA Current sense amplifier reference supply input (CSAREF) -0.3 4 V Current sense amplifier output (SOx) -0.3 4 V Output pin voltage (OUTA, OUTB, OUTC) –1 VM + 1 (2) V Ambient temperature, TA –40 125 °C Junction temperature, TJ –40 150 °C Storage tempertaure, Tstg –65 150 °C (1) Operation outside the Absolute Maximum Ratings may cause permanent device damage. Absolute Maximum Ratings do not imply functional operation of the device at these or any other conditions beyond those listed under Recommended Operating Conditions. If used outside the Recommended Operating Conditions but within the Absolute Maximum Ratings, the device may not be fully functional, and this may affect device reliability, functionality, performance, and shorten the device lifetime (2) Maximum voltage supported on OUTx pin is 24V 7.2 ESD Ratings VALUE UNIT V(ESD) Electrostatic discharge Human body model (HBM), per ANSI/ESDA/JEDEC JS-001(1) ±2500 V Charged device model (CDM), per JEDEC specification JESD22-C101(2) ±750 (1) JEDEC document JEP155 states that 500-V HBM allows safe manufacturing with a standard ESD control process. (2) JEDEC document JEP157 states that 250-V CDM allows safe manufacturing with a standard ESD control process. 7.3 Recommended Operating Conditions over operating ambient temperature range (unless otherwise noted) MIN NOM MAX UNIT VVM Power supply voltage VVM, VVIN_AVDD 4.5 12 20 V IOUT (1) Peak output winding current VVM ≥ 6 V, OUTA, OUTB, OUTC 5 A 4.5 V ≤ VVM < 6 V, OUTA, OUTB, OUTC 3 A VOD Open drain pullup voltage nFAULT –0.3 5.5 V IOD Open drain output current capability nFAULT 5 mA TA Operating ambient temperature –40 125 °C TJ Operating Junction temperature –40 150 °C (1) Power dissipation and thermal limits must be observed DRV8317 SLVSGT3 – DECEMBER 2022 www.ti.com 6 Submit Document Feedback Copyright © 2022 Texas Instruments Incorporated Product Folder Links: DRV8317 |
